Campsite Use
Waterfall on the Little Sur River

There are 12 primitive tenting campsites available for Scout units and other groups. The campsites are different sizes, and can accommodate 10 - 50 tents. Each campsite has shared flush toilet and shower buildings, as well as fire pits. Restoration of the facilities is currently underway. At this time, Campsite 1 & 2 are available to reserve.

Facility Extras
Inside the Hayward Lodge at dusk

The camp is a full service camp that has great facilities that can be rented in addition to the campsites. The Hayward Lodge, Bing Crosby Kitchen, Nature Lodge, Handicraft, Trading Post, Fire Bowl, Climbing Tower, Archery Range, Rifle Range, Pistol Range, and Shotgun Range may all be available for an extra charge during your stay. The target sports areas and climbing wall have special requirements in order to use them.

Hiking Trails
Trail sign at Pico

The has several hiking trails that are currently being reestablished after 7 years of non-use. There is access to Los Padres National Forest from trails leading out of the camp property to the Forest Service wilderness campgrounds. Little Sur Camp, Jackson Camp, Fish Camp, Pico Camp, and Launtz Camp are popular destinations as well as hiking  Mt. Pico Blanco. Volunteers are welcome to serve on the trail restoration crews.
